Florence Pivert Appointed as Head, People & Culture Pharma International at Roche

Florence Pivert Appointed as Head, People & Culture Pharma International at Roche

TweetPostShareWhatsapp

Basel, Basel-Town, Switzerland, April 2025 – Florence Pivert has stepped into the role of Head, People & Culture Pharma International at Roche, bringing nearly two decades of cross-functional leadership experience within the organization. In her new position, she will lead the global people agenda for Roche’s pharmaceutical business across international markets, further advancing the company’s commitment to personalized healthcare and inclusive leadership.

Florence has served Roche for over 18 years, most recently as Global Head of Pharma Technical People & Culture for five years, where she was instrumental in transforming the global HR function for the technical division. Her tenure included spearheading global cultural initiatives and enhancing talent development strategies.

Previously, she held the position of Head of HR Pharma Technical Operations Basel-Kaiseraugst and Global HR Business Partner for the Global Pharma Technical Supply Chain, where she led the HRBP team and provided strategic guidance across operations in Switzerland.

Florence’s earlier roles at Roche included Global HR Business Partner for Pharma Technical Operations – Quality, Head of Human Resources Business Partners, and Head of Strategic Analytics in France, showcasing her versatility in both people and data-driven roles.

Before joining Roche, Florence built a strong foundation in corporate communications and customer experience at Terumo Europe NV and Guerbet, holding senior roles such as European Communication Manager, Customer Delight Manager, and Vice President, Communication.

About Roche

Roche is a global leader in pharmaceuticals and diagnostics, pioneering advances in personalized healthcare. Headquartered in Switzerland, Roche is the world’s largest biotech company, known for its innovative medicines in oncology, immunology, infectious diseases, and neuroscience. With a strong presence in diagnostics and diabetes management, Roche continues to make a sustainable contribution to society. The company is consistently recognized as a sustainability leader and is committed to improving patient access to life-saving therapies.
